Kim Kardashian shares Tokyo family moments as Lewis Hamilton trip draws attention

A family outing in Tokyo

According to Kirsty Hatcher’s March 26, 2026 article in PEOPLE, Kim Kardashian shared a series of Instagram Stories showing moments from a museum visit in Tokyo with her children Saint, Chicago, and Psalm. The updates offered a casual look at the family’s time in Japan, with clips of the children exploring the space and interacting with the exhibits while Kardashian filmed and joined in.

The report says the group visited teamLab Planets, where Kardashian posted footage of her sons playing on a mat and other family moments inside the immersive attraction.

In one part of the visit, she was seen posing with Chicago, while other clips showed playful exchanges with Psalm and affectionate interactions with her nephew Tatum. The social media posts gave followers a personal window into the trip and reinforced the relaxed, family centered tone of the vacation.

PEOPLE also reported that Khloé Kardashian joined the Japan trip with her children, True and Tatum, making the getaway a larger family outing rather than a solo visit. PEOPLE report connects the trip to Lewis Hamilton

According to PEOPLE, a source said Kardashian was traveling in Tokyo with Hamilton as he prepared for this weekend’s Formula 1 activity in Japan.

The article places the vacation just before the Japan Grand Prix, scheduled from March 27 to March 29 at Suzuka Circuit in Suzuka City, which makes the timing especially notable given the ongoing attention surrounding the pair.

The same report notes that Kardashian and Hamilton have been linked publicly since early February and have been seen together in several locations, including England, Paris, California, and Arizona.
